From b4a261855b34b4c8d938118762ae609a34a3ae99 Mon Sep 17 00:00:00 2001 From: Tom Sepez Date: Wed, 1 Mar 2017 12:15:00 -0800 Subject: Create virtual codec APIs so chrome/fuzzers can link separately The one step to make an actual concrete class is conditionalized in fpdfview and is unconditional in the fuzzer. Also replace the clumsy C-style callbacks with a delegate interface as long as we are making new interfaces.
